Publisher's Summary

There is only one CEO in recent times who has faced, and succeeded at, the extraordinary challenges of leading three major companies ¿ Gillette, Nabisco, and Kraft ¿ into prosperous futures by doing what matters on the fundamentals. That CEO is Jim Kilts. In this vivid first-person account, he reveals his system for success, which is both cutting-edge and back-to-basics.

Doing What Matters - the action plan for identifying and tackling what's important and ignoring the rest - is the key to winning in a warp-speed world where the need for revolutionary speed and decisiveness increases by the day.

Kilts illustrates his ideas with colorful stories. His focus on both business fundamentals and personal attributes provides the "complete package", showing how to get results that make a difference through intellectual integrity, emotional engagement and enthusiasm, action, and understanding the right things via an overarching concept.

Whether you're the CEO of a multibillion-dollar global company, the brand manager for a product, an entrepreneur starting a small business, or just beginning a career, Doing What Matters provides practical ideas that get results.
